  1. How Do I Grow Tomatoes Successfully?

Cultivating tomatoes is a rewarding venture, and success starts with the basics:

  • Sunshine Lover: Tomatoes thrive in sunlight. Ensure your plants receive at least 6-8 hours of direct sunlight daily.
  • Well-Drained Soil: Plant tomatoes in well-draining soil to prevent waterlogging, a common woe for these plants.
  • Watering Wisely: Keep the soil consistently moist, but avoid overwatering. Irregular watering can lead to issues like blossom end rot.
  • Support Systems: Many tomato varieties benefit from staking or caging to support their growth and prevent sprawling.
  1. Why Do My Tomatoes Have Cracks?

Cracked tomatoes can be a bit disappointing, but understanding the causes can help prevent this issue:

  • Inconsistent Watering: Fluctuations in watering, especially irregular watering followed by heavy watering, can lead to cracks.
  • Variety Matters: Some tomato varieties are more prone to cracking. Consider growing crack-resistant varieties.
  • Weather Factors: Rapid changes in weather, particularly fluctuations in temperature and humidity, can contribute to cracking.
  1. Can I Grow Tomatoes in Containers?

Absolutely! Container gardening is a fantastic option, especially for those with limited space. Here’s how to make it successful:

  • Choose the Right Container: Opt for large containers with good drainage to accommodate the tomato’s root system.
  • Quality Soil: Use high-quality potting soil that provides the necessary nutrients.
  • Support the Plant: Many compact or determinate tomato varieties do well in containers. Use stakes or cages for support.
  1. How Can I Ripen Green Tomatoes?

Sometimes you find yourself with a bounty of green tomatoes. Fear not, as you can ripen them indoors:

  • Paper Bag Method: Place green tomatoes in a paper bag with a ripe banana. The ethylene gas from the banana speeds up ripening.
  • Windowsill Ripening: Arrange green tomatoes on a sunny windowsill, and they’ll gradually ripen.
  1. What’s the Best Way to Store Tomatoes?

Proper storage ensures your tomatoes stay fresh and flavourful:

  • Room Temperature: Keep fully ripe tomatoes at room temperature for the best flavour. Only refrigerate if they’re overripe and need to be used soon.
  • Separate from Fruits: Store tomatoes away from fruits like bananas and apples, as these release ethylene gas, which can hasten ripening.
